WebMar 15, 2024 · The Valsalva maneuver is the classic vagal maneuver used to stimulate the vagus nerve and stop SVT. This is used on patients who are stable (stable vital signs) and can follow commands. To perform the Valsalva maneuver, the patient intentionally “bears down” or strains for 10-15 seconds. This has a 17% success rate in converting SVT.

A person may develop an acute cough after breathing in certain environmental irritants. Examples include: 1. cigarette smoke 2. diesel fumes 3. perfumes or colognes Inhaling irritants can cause symptoms similar to those of allergic rhinitis.
